Sex education program for teenagers in Uganda
"Reproductive health" – the action program of the 1994 UN World Population Conference uses this rather unwieldy term to describe an important objective: that all people should be able to have a safe sex life. Women should only become pregnant if they want to. Bayer HealthCare Pharmaceuticals informs people about family-planning methods and makes it easier for them to access contraceptives – above all in poor countries.
Bayer HealthCare Pharmaceuticals collaborates with various non-governmental organizations to offer sex-education programs that take people's age, gender and differing cultural sensitivities into account. One example is the 'Youth2Youth' project run by the German Foundation for World Population (DSW). Together with the DSW, we have launched a unique educational program for young teenagers under the age of 15 in Uganda. The aim of 'Youth2Youth' is to encourage responsible behavior in the target group. The underlying idea is that the information that young people receive comes from their peers, is adapted to local conditions, and is supported by a 'Youth Bus'.
